- Description:
- Printed on assignment sheet: "Braves vs. Mets. In the third inning, in a second base controversy Friday night, Braves Andre Thomas, right, is restrained by fellow Brave Jeff Treadway as he argues with and base umpire Barnes about a play there. Thomas had missed a tag at second on Mets Howard Johnson." Caption: "Andres Thomas is restrained by Jeff Treadway as he argues call he missed tag. Saturday July 7, 1990"
